Bruny Island Neck – Fairy Penguins

The Neck - Bruny Island. Image credit: Tourism Australia

Our island state is known for its natural beauty. It’s also a haven for wildlife, with important habitat dotted throughout Tasmania. One of these special places is the Bruny Island Neck Game Reserve, a key habitat for little penguins, short-tailed shearwaters, and other bird life.
